That bloke that did ghost walks round Accy was in the Telegraph a while back about a young woman related to the old Saxon lords of Accrington. Load of bull there are only males listed in the old documents relating to Accrington back in the 1100's. I emailed him and asked him to produce documentry evidence. Guess what I got no reply. There used to be tales of a ghostly female form appearing down at Dunkenhalgh. The Accrington Pals put that to rest when the were on manouvres one night. Turned out to be mist rising of the stream. It was rumoured that there is a ghost in the Stop and Rest Ossy, which I took with a pinch of salt until one week in the 70s when Jack Catlow was standing in for the landlord and the brother-in-law myself were having a dink after closing, all the doors were locked (the inside doors had security locks) when we all heard the taproom door open and we look through the opening to see who it was, nothing:eek: the place went ice cold and so did we, especially when we remembered that the door was locked, I have never seen three blokes vacate a building so fast before. When the landlord return, we told him, he just laughed and said ah its only oud Bill getting his nightcap:eek::eek::eek:
